What Is a Floor Tech?

What is a floor tech, really? At its core, the term “floor tech” refers to a professional who specializes in the technical aspects of flooring installation and management. Unlike someone who might simply lay down carpet or hardwood, a floor tech combines hands-on skills with deep knowledge about materials, installation techniques, cost estimation, and project management.

You might think of a floor tech as the “flooring problem solver.” They’re the person who understands how different types of flooring behave under various conditions, how to plan for complex shapes and spaces, and how to manage budgets effectively. In many ways, they’re the backbone of any successful flooring project.

I often describe the floor tech role as a bridge between design aspirations and practical execution. When architects or interior designers dream up stunning floors, it’s the floor tech who figures out how to make that vision reality—balancing aesthetics with real-world challenges like subfloor conditions, moisture levels, and material availability.

The Breadth of a Floor Tech’s Role

A floor tech typically handles:

  • Precise measurements and site assessments
  • Material selection advice based on project needs
  • Cost estimation and budgeting (a big one!)
  • Planning for waste and recycling
  • Coordinating with installation teams
  • Troubleshooting unexpected issues during installation
  • Ensuring the finished floor meets quality and durability standards

In my 15+ years in flooring, I’ve seen this role expand as new materials and technologies emerge. For example, today’s floor techs might work with luxury vinyl planks with complex locking systems or eco-friendly bamboo flooring that requires special adhesives. Keeping up to date is part of the job.

1. Precision Measurement and Planning

One of the first things I do as a floor tech is detailed site measurement. You might think measuring rooms is simple—just grab a tape measure and jot down numbers. But trust me, it’s far more complicated when you deal with irregular spaces, multiple angles, staircases, thresholds, and transitions between types of flooring.

I use laser measuring tools now because they provide incredible accuracy. On one recent project, I measured a sunroom with three angled walls and discovered the original blueprints underestimated square footage by about 4%. Over several hundred square feet, that difference meant ordering fewer materials upfront and avoiding extra delivery fees.

Here’s something interesting: studies show that even small measurement errors can lead to material waste costing between 5% to 15% of total flooring costs. In some cases, inaccurate measurement causes delays while waiting for additional materials to arrive.

Planning also means factoring in waste — something many people overlook. When cutting tile or hardwood planks around corners or doorways, leftover scraps often can’t be reused. Depending on the material and room shape, I usually add between 7% and 10% extra material to cover this waste.

A tip I always share: if you’re measuring yourself, double-check your numbers. Measure twice (or thrice!), especially complicated areas. And if possible, get a professional floor tech involved early—they have tools and experience to catch mistakes before it’s too late.

2. Mastery of Material Selection

Choosing the right flooring material isn’t just about looks—although that matters! It’s about selecting options that fit your lifestyle, budget, and environment.

Early in my career, I learned this lesson firsthand. A client loved the warmth of engineered hardwood but wanted it installed in her basement kitchen area—a space prone to humidity changes. Within six months, several boards started buckling due to moisture exposure.

Since then, I’ve made it my mission to educate clients on how different materials respond to real conditions.

For example:

  • Hardwood: Beautiful but sensitive to moisture; best for dry areas.
  • Engineered wood: More stable than hardwood but still vulnerable to water.
  • Vinyl plank: Waterproof options great for kitchens and basements.
  • Tile: Durable and water-resistant but cold underfoot.
  • Carpet: Soft but less durable in high traffic or damp areas.

Vinyl plank flooring has exploded in popularity because it offers waterproof properties combined with realistic wood or stone looks. According to the Floor Covering Industry Statistics report from 2023, vinyl plank sales grew by nearly 25% in the last five years due to these benefits.

When helping clients pick materials, I consider:

  • Traffic levels (kids? pets? commercial use?)
  • Moisture exposure (basement? bathroom?)
  • Maintenance expectations (how much cleaning effort?)
  • Budget constraints
  • Desired aesthetics

This holistic approach prevents costly mistakes and leads to happier clients long term.

4. Troubleshooting Installation Challenges

No construction site is perfect. Even with great planning, unexpected problems arise during installation—and this is where a floor tech’s problem-solving skills come into play.

Take moisture issues for example. I had one basement renovation where waterproofing was installed properly but moisture still seeped through the concrete slab underneath after heavy rains. We had already ordered hardwood planks but realized mid-installation these would warp badly.

We quickly pivoted to luxury vinyl planks known for water resistance. That decision saved the client from future headaches—and extra repair costs that could have exceeded $10K if ignored.

Another common challenge is uneven subfloors. In older homes especially, floors settle or shift over time creating dips or slopes. Installing tile or hardwood over an uneven surface leads to cracking or squeaks later on.

I use digital levels and moisture meters routinely to check subfloor conditions before laying materials down. If necessary, self-leveling compounds or plywood overlays fix problems early.

Being able to adapt plans on-site helps keep timelines intact too—contractors hate costly delays caused by reordering materials or redoing work.

5. Efficient Waste Management and Sustainability

I’ve always been passionate about reducing waste in my projects—not just because it saves money but because it’s better for the planet.

Flooring materials can be pricey—and throwing away scraps adds up fast both financially and environmentally. According to EPA reports, construction debris including flooring accounts for hundreds of millions of tons of landfill waste annually in the U.S.

A floor tech plans waste carefully by ordering just enough material plus reasonable extras for cuts (never over-ordering wildly), reusing scraps when possible (like mosaic tiles), and recycling leftover pieces through local programs.

For instance, on one commercial job with patterned tile floors covering 3,000 sq ft., we recycled over 30% of leftover tile scraps into decorative wall panels for client lobbies—clients loved seeing waste turned into art.

Some manufacturers even offer take-back programs for unused materials—floor techs stay updated on these options to promote sustainability wherever possible.

My Personal Experience: A Case Study in Detail

Let me walk you through a recent project where all these elements came together perfectly—and hopefully illustrate what makes a floor tech so impactful.

A community center needed its main hall redone—about 5,000 square feet heavily trafficked by visitors daily. The existing floor was old vinyl that had started peeling, creating tripping hazards and an outdated look.

Step 1: Detailed Assessment & Measurement

I started by measuring every inch using laser tools—this took longer than usual because the hall had multiple alcoves and columns interrupting the space.

Cross-checking against original blueprints revealed small discrepancies amounting to about 3% extra area than documented—important data that ensured we didn’t under-order materials.

Step 2: Material Selection & Client Education

The client wanted something durable yet attractive with easy maintenance. Based on heavy foot traffic and occasional spills (coffee machines nearby), I recommended luxury vinyl planks with commercial wear layers rated for high use.

I shared data from industry sources showing vinyl plank lifespans averaging 15–20 years under commercial use vs hardwood’s potential damage from moisture exposure in similar environments.

Step 3: Cost Estimation Using FloorTally

Using FloorTally software, I input measurements along with local labor rates for my team and local suppliers’ pricing on vinyl flooring plus underlayment/mastic needed for installation.

The tool generated an itemized estimate:

Cost ItemAmount ($)
Vinyl Planks12,500
Underlayment & Adhesives1,800
Labor (installation)7,200
Waste Factor (8%)1,120
Miscellaneous400
Total Estimate23,020

The client appreciated seeing where every dollar went rather than just a lump sum quote.

Step 4: Installation & Troubleshooting

During prep work we discovered some uneven subfloor sections around columns causing dips exceeding recommended tolerances.

We applied self-leveling compound in those areas before starting vinyl installation—the added effort prevented future wear issues from uneven support beneath planks.

Step 5: Waste Management & Finishing Touches

After installation there were some leftover vinyl scraps—rather than discarding them we cut pieces into mats placed at entryways reducing dirt tracked inside—a practical reuse appreciated by staff.

The project wrapped up two days ahead of schedule with costs staying within estimate—a testament to thorough planning and problem-solving throughout.

Diving Deeper Into Flooring Materials: Insights From a Floor Tech Perspective

Since material selection is so crucial, let me share some insights based on years working across residential and commercial projects:

Hardwood Flooring

Hardwood remains popular due to its timeless appeal but demands respect for its limitations:

  • Sensitive to humidity changes causing expansion/contraction.
  • Requires acclimation period before installation.
  • Needs regular maintenance like refinishing every few years.

Data from The Hardwood Flooring Manufacturers Association shows well-maintained hardwood floors can last over 50 years—but only if installed properly in suitable environments.

Engineered Wood

Engineered wood offers more stability thanks to plywood base layers beneath hardwood veneers:

  • Better suited for basements & ground floors.
  • Easier installation due to click-lock systems.
  • Still vulnerable to standing water damage.

I often recommend engineered wood where appearance matters but moisture risk exists—like kitchens adjacent to living rooms.

Vinyl Plank & Tile

Vinyl’s waterproof nature makes it ideal for high-moisture areas:

  • Comes in rigid core or flexible versions.
  • High wear layer thickness improves durability.
  • Some styles mimic wood grain or stone convincingly.

Industry sales data from Freedonia Group shows vinyl flooring market growing steadily at about 6% annually due to these advantages.

Tile Flooring

Tile offers unmatched durability but requires skillful installation over leveled substrates:

  • Porcelain tiles resist stains & water better than ceramic.
  • Grout maintenance critical for longevity.

Properly installed tile floors can last decades but improper prep causes cracking—floor tech expertise here is vital.

Carpet Flooring

Carpet still holds appeal for softness & warmth:

  • Less suitable for allergy sufferers due to dust retention.
  • Shorter lifespan compared to hard surfaces.

Carpets need regular cleaning; selecting stain-resistant fibers makes maintenance easier in busy homes or offices.
